#F741BD Hex color

#F741BD

The hexadecimal color code #F741BD corresponds to the code RGB( 247, 65, 189 ). It's a shade of Pink. This color is a combination of red (at 0,97 level), green (at 0,25 level) and blue (at 0,74 level). Its brightness is 61% and its saturation is 91%. It is composed of red at 49%, green at 12% and blue at 37%.
